How does Alaska Airlines compare to other major airlines?
Alaska Airlines often stands out due to its customer service and on-time performance, which can be better than some larger carriers.
What are the baggage policies for Alaska Airlines?
Alaska Airlines allows one carry-on bag and one personal item for free, while checked baggage fees apply based on your fare type.
Is there in-flight Wi-Fi on Alaska Airlines?
Yes, Alaska Airlines offers in-flight Wi-Fi on many of its flights, but it may come with a fee.
What rewards does the Mileage Plan offer?
The Mileage Plan offers a variety of rewards, including free flights, upgrades, and partner benefits with other airlines and services.
